Pupil destinations (2016 leavers)
Pupil destinations (education and employment after key stage 4) Click to expand
This data, published in January 2019, is for pupils who completed key stage 4 opens a popup in 2016, which is the most recent data available.
You can compare the pupils’ destinations with those of pupils at state-funded schools at local authority and national level.
Pupils staying in education or employment | School | Local authority | England |
---|---|---|---|
Pupils staying in education or employment for at least 2 terms after key stage 4
more info Click to expand
Any sustained education, apprenticeship or employment destination. |
91% | 93% | 94% |
Total number of pupils included in destination measures
more info Click to expand
Number of pupils who finished key stage 4 (year 11) in 2016. |
107 | 1395 | 541120 |
Pupils staying in education | |||
Pupils staying in education for at least 2 terms after key stage 4
more info Click to expand
Pupils who were in education throughout the first 2 terms, October 2016 to March 2017. |
86% | 89% | 86% |
Further education college or other further education provider
more info Click to expand
Includes pupils studying further education in a higher education institution. School sixth forms and sixth-form colleges are shown separately. |
29% | 41% | 34% |
School sixth form | 52% | 39% | 38% |
Sixth form college | 5% | 7% | 13% |
